Title: To authorize and direct the Director of Recreation and Parks to revise the lease agreements with Youth rowing clubs, enter into new lease agreements; and to declare and emergency.
Explanation
 
Background:
Authorize the Director of Recreation and Parks to enter into lease agreements with the Academic - Youth Rowing Clubs, consisting of Dublin High School Club, Upper Arlington High School Club, Hilliard High School Club, Westerville High School Club, OSU Crew Club, and Dennison Crew Club
 
The agreements will be for a term of five (5) years
 
The City of Columbus Recreation and Parks Department is requesting the approval to revise the Lease agreements to include the following revisions:
-We are requesting that we offer the Academic - Youth Rowing Clubs a 25% reduction from their total lease agreement fees.  New fees will become $230.00 per dock and $130.00 per boat yearly. This will allow for continued support of the Academic-Youth Rowing Programs and continual partnership between City of Columbus, Recreation and parks and the Academic-youth Rowing Programs.
-We are requesting that we extend the lease agreement term from 2 years to 5 years.  This will allow for a longer agreement to be in place, as the academic youth clubs have expressed interest in the longer term for the Lease Agreement.  This will also allow for the continued occupancy for Griggs, Hoover, and O'shaghnessy Reservoirs.
 
This ordinance is being submitted as an emergency to renew lease agreement and for the revisions to become effective immediately.
